Elisabetta Gualmini, S&D member of the European Parliament and Professor of Bologna University, and László Andor, FEPS Secretary General, discuss in this FEPS Talks podcast episode the chance of the Multiannual Financial Framework (MFF) to be adopted in time. They also analyse the nature and the implementation of the Recovery Plan, from the perspective of progressive requirements. As member of the EP Committee on Budgets, Gualmini highlights the importance of innovation in the area of own resources. She clarifies that this is not about taxing the citizens but the big companies and multinationals with a new type of taxation like the digital or the carbon tax. Gualmini and Andor agree on the need to bring back to the table the Financial Transaction Tax and they also highlight the innovative aspects of Next Generation EU like the common debt and the grants (even if there is still no clarity about some aspects like the loan repayment). Finally, they extend the discussion to rule of law conditionality and the job creation potential of EU budget instruments.
